Participants will be able to learn the science behind air pollution and how to detect air-pollutants such as NH3 and PhH in the air. This kit can be use at home, school or office setting where air quality will be monitor. We wish to increase public’s awareness on the importance of reducing air pollution in Hong Kong which can enhance human health and build a more sustainable society.
